MF is a file extension used by java and is put into java archive files (JAR files) and this file contains specific information about the packages included in the Java Archive file in which it resides. The MF file is a crucial file and is mandatory to be present in every JAR file having the default location as 'META-INF/MANIFEST.MF' within the archive file. This file essentially contains special metadata regarding the java files and packages contained within the java archive file. It gives other important information along with that such as the version of the application, the main class file that should be invoked on double-clicking or executing the jar file, etc. This MF file is a simple plain text file and can be opened or edited using any standard editor.
